The nuclear spin-lattice relaxation rate divided by temperature $1/T_1T$ shows a prominent peak at 5.5 K, below which a Co-NQR peak splits due to an internal field at the Co site. From analyses of the Co NQR spectrum at 1.5 K, the internal field is evaluated to be $\\sim$ 300 Oe and is in the $ab$-plane.
